^ yeah man, I researched the **** out of my rims, looked at dozens of pictures on the internet of both +22 and +12 TE37s. Pretty unbelievable the difference 10mm makes, definitely the perfect rim IMO.
Also the stretch on the tires, I researched alot and I think I got the perfect stretch, 225/40 on the front 245/40 on the rear. Basically the stock tires on a 9.5' and 10.5' wheel.
